bakgrunnskönnun
Bakgrunnskönnun is a term used in Norwegian and other Nordic languages to describe the process of a background check. It involves collecting and evaluating information about a person to assess suitability for employment, a security clearance, licensing, or other authorized purposes. The goal is to verify identity and establish a reliable profile of relevant past behavior and credentials.
